Product Description:

The Rexroth Indramat 2AD160C-B35OB1-DD03-D2N3 is an AC induction motor that has been specifically designed for CNC systems and robotics. The motor provides precise and dependable performance with a nominal capacity of 46 kW. The motor operates at a nominal speed of 2000 min⁻¹. The motor is designed to deliver the highest level of efficacy and durability throughout the most demanding applications.

The nominal current of the 2AD160C-B35OB1-DD03-D2N3 motor is 109 Aeff, which guarantees constant operation under typical load conditions. Its peak speed of 6000 min⁻¹ enables it to operate at high speeds when necessary. The motor is suitable for applications requiring medium to high torque, thanks to its nominal moment of 220 Nm. The motor uses an axial airflow cooling system, which guarantees efficient heat dissipation during operation. Power connections are made through the top terminal box, and they are oriented towards side B. The motor is equipped with a high-resolution feedback device to ensure precise control and positioning. The motor is designed with a calibrated shaft, shaft seal, and entire key to improve performance and reliability. The motor's versatility in design allows for both flange and foot mounting, adding to its ease of installation.

The 2AD160C-B35OB1-DD03-D2N3 motor does not have a holding brake and comes with regular bearings. The length code of the motor is C, which provides a specific design that facilitates integration into a variety of systems. The motor is a member of the 2AD 3-Phase Induction Motor series. The motor is designated as S1 for vibration, ensuring that vibration levels are low during operation. The motor is appropriate for a variety of industrial automation applications due to its specifications and adaptable design.
